Abstract
The utility model is related to dome light source fields, and in particular to a kind of dome light source of efficient detection, including carrying mouth, dome reflecting surface, supporting shell, bolt, transmission line, support base, screw, LED light face and protective cover.Carrying mouth is located at the top of the supporting shell;The transmission line is connected to the LED light face;The bolt fastens supporting shell and support base;The protective cover is located at the lower section of the supporting shell;The screw is located at the top of the supporting shell;The dome reflecting surface is in contact with the inner surface of the supporting shell;The lower section of the carrying mouth is the protective cover;The top of the support base is the LED light face.After LED lamp bead after the utility model structure optimization is after spheric reflection, it can smoothly, equably be radiated at testee surface.The utility model have larger light-diffusing surface, can Omnibearing even be radiated on testee, improve the efficiency of detection.

As Figure 1-Figure 2, the dome light source of a kind of efficient detection, including carrying mouth 1, dome reflecting surface 2, support
Shell 3, bolt 4, transmission line 5, support base 6, screw 7, LED light face 8 and protective cover 9.The carrying mouth 1 is located at the support
The top of shell 3;The transmission line 5 is electrically connected the LED light face 8;The bolt 4 fastens supporting shell 3 and branch
Support seat 6;The protective cover 9 is located at the lower section of the supporting shell 3;The screw 7 is located at the upper of the supporting shell 3
Side;The dome reflecting surface 2 is in contact with the inner surface of the supporting shell 3;The top of the support base 6 is described
LED light face 8.
Operation principle:Electric current is transmitted in the LED light face 8 by the transmission line 5;It sends out in the LED light face 8
Light, light reflex to lower section by the dome reflecting surface 2;Light penetrates the protective cover 9, expands range, to production
Product are detected.The protective cover 9 is welded in the supporting shell 3.The supporting shell 3 is photosensitive resin material.Institute
The support base 6 stated is welded in the supporting shell 3.The protective cover 9 is located at the lower section of the support base 6.
